#388690 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#388690 is composed of 22% red, 52.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.1%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 186.8 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 39.2%. #388690 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#000d21.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#388690 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#388690 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#388690 has RGB values of R:56, G:134,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3704464.

Shades and Tints of #388690
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f4f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#388690
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e686a is the less saturated color, while #02b0c6 is the most saturated one.
